Where is maize made?

Maize is a cereal grain that was domesticated in Mesoamerica and then spread throughout the American continents. Maize spread to the rest of the world after European contact with the Americas in the late 15th century and early 16th century.

Where did penuts and maize become important crops?

Peanuts and maize became important crops primarily in the Americas. Maize, or corn, originated in Mesoamerica, particularly in present-day Mexico, and became a staple food for many Indigenous cultures. Peanuts, native to South America, were also cultivated by Indigenous peoples and later spread across the continent. Both crops played significant roles in agriculture and diets, influencing economies and cuisines throughout the Americas.
